How to Change Default Salesperson at Sales Order Entry?

(0) ShareShare
ReportReport
Posted on by 105

Please let me know how I can change the default salesperson from being populated in the commissions window at the time I create a new sales order. It seems the system has been setup to always default to the same individual and I am not sure how to change it. Any input is greatly appreciated. Thanks.

    Hi, I believe this comes from Customer class, so changing there should resolve the issue.

    Delete the Salesperson from the Customer Card if it's just for one specific customer.  If it's for a number of customers, delete it from the Customer Class and roll down the change to the Class members, as John suggests.

    That didn't work but I think I found what seems to be causing the problem. The customer had multiple Ship To Addresses and each of those addresses had different sales people assigned to it.  Now, I need to figure out a way to mass change the salesperson for all of the Ship To Addresses to the individual that I want. Is that possible?

    Yes, with Integration Manager, you could do a mass update by running an Update integration on the Address ID.  Or, you could do it very simply in SQL by updating the RM00102 (Customer Address Master) field (SLPRSNID) directly with the appropriate Salesperson ID.  Make sure you back up the database prior to making changes to the tables.
